The Consulares Syriae

Downey goes on to list the holders of this title. Many of these graduated to become the Comes Orientis. 

Hierocles 344 (9th Dec)
Theodorus 347 (8 March) 
Hierocles 348 (24 April)
Honoratus (date unknown)
Theophilus 354
Nicentius 358 (Summer)
Sabinus  358-359 (Autumn)
Tryphonianus 359-360
Italicianus 360
Siderius 361
Alexander 363 (Feb or Mar until July)
Celsus 363 (Summer)
Marcianus 364
Festus 365 or 368
Aetherius before Fall of 371
Tatianus between 370 and 374
Marcellinus 382
Pelagius 382 or 383
Eumolpius 384
Tisamenus 386
Timocrates after 382 possibly in 387
Celsus 387
Lucianus 388 (until March - August)
Eustathius 388 (March - August) - 389 (January - June)
Eutropius 389 (after January - June)
Infantius between 389 -392
Florentius 392 (after Sept)
Severus before 393

Downey also these these individual that may have held the office:

Dionysius 355
Gymnasius 355-6
Capitolinus 391
Polemius before 392
